Stacy Bare

Stacy Bare is the director of the Sierra Club Outdoors program. A climber, mountaineer, and skier, climbing helped Stacy recover from PTS and readjustment issues from a year in Baghdad as a Civil Affairs Team Leader in the Army. He is the recipient of the Bronze Star for merit and a combat action badge in Baghdad as well as being named one of National Geographic’s Adventurers of the Year for 2014.​
